Wall Street looks up to the Navy, not fellow traders

Who are Wall Street’s heroes?

Fuhgeddabout Michael Lewis of HFT “Flash Boys” fame and Leonardo DiCaprio, who starred in “The Wolf of Wall Street.”

No, it’s patriots like US Navy SEAL Jason Redman whom traders most admire, On the Money has learned.

Redman bravely conducted more than 40 life-or-death missions.

The intrepid SEAL was critically wounded in Iraq in 2007 and survived to tell his story in his book, “The Trident.”

“This author has never appeared on ‘60 Minutes,’ and no movies have been made about him yet,” said Jim Toes
, who is chief executive of the Security Traders Association of trading professionals centered in New York, which recently hosted Redman.

Toes can’t say enough good stuff about Redman.

“In his book, Jason shares his never-quit story, which we all should try to incorporate into our lives. But it is his honesty which resonates with all who meet him and have the privilege to be in his company,” Toes said.
